This presentation explains how Artificial Intelligence (AI) is transforming healthcare through automation, data analysis, and decision-making. It discusses applications, research progress, and challenges.
🔹 Key Sections Summary
1. Introduction
Defines AI in healthcare and explains its purpose — using algorithms to improve diagnostics, treatment, and patient management.
2. History and Evolution
Traces the journey from early expert systems (like MYCIN) to modern deep learning and robotic surgeries, highlighting major technological milestones.
3. AI in Diagnostics
Explains machine learning models that detect diseases from X-rays, MRIs, and pathology images. AI improves speed and accuracy in early disease detection.
4. AI in Treatment Planning
Covers robotic surgeries, personalized medicine, and AI models predicting treatment outcomes or drug effectiveness.
5. AI in Patient Care and Monitoring
Describes wearables and IoT-enabled devices that track patient vitals, predict health risks, and improve preventive care. Chatbots assist patients 24/7.
6. Ethical and Legal Challenges
Discusses privacy, data security, algorithmic bias, and lack of regulatory clarity in healthcare AI systems.
7. Future Scope
Focuses on integration of AI with genomics, biotechnology, and global telemedicine platforms, aiming for “AI-powered hospitals.”
8. Conclusion
Summarizes benefits like accuracy and efficiency but stresses the need for ethical governance and transparency in future AI healthcare systems.
